    Additive Manufacturing in Materials Science for Science Fiction Writers

    If you're a science fiction writer exploring futuristic technologies, Additive Manufacturing (AM) in materials science can be a concept to incorporate into your stories.

    What is Additive Manufacturing?

    At its core, Additive Manufacturing is a method of fabricating objects by adding material layer upon layer, as opposed to traditional subtractive methods that remove material from a larger block. This additive approach enables the creation of complex geometries and intricate designs, which would be difficult or impossible to achieve using conventional manufacturing techniques.

    Materials in Additive Manufacturing

    AM empowers scientists and engineers to work with a wide range of materials, opening up possibilities for your science fiction worlds. Here are some materials commonly used in Additive Manufacturing:

    Plastics and Polymers: These materials are versatile and commonly employed in AM because of their ease of processing and wide availability.

    Metal Alloys: AM allows for the precise fabrication of metal components, enabling the creation of lightweight and intricate structures.

    Ceramics: Ceramic materials possess unique properties like high-temperature resistance and electrical insulation. This makes them valuable for various applications.

    Composites: By combining multiple materials, like fibers or nanoparticles, composite materials offer enhanced strength, durability, and other tailored properties.

    Applications of Additive Manufacturing

    The applications of AM in materials science are vast and varied, offering plenty of narrative opportunities for science fiction writers. Here are a few examples:

    Customized Prosthetics: AM enables the production of personalized prosthetic limbs, tailored to fit an individual's unique anatomy and needs.

    Space Exploration: In your science fiction universe, imagine astronauts using AM to manufacture tools, spare parts, and habitats during long space missions.

    Bioprinting: AM technologies can also print living tissues and organs, paving the way for advanced medical treatments and organ transplants.

    Nanotechnology: By combining AM with nanomaterials, scientists can fabricate intricate nanostructures with specific properties, leading to advancements in electronics, sensors, and energy storage.

    Challenges and Limitations

    While AM holds potential, it's essential to consider the challenges and limitations associated with this technology for a well-rounded science fiction narrative. Here are an aspects to remember:

    Material Limitations: Not all materials are easily printable, and some may require additional processing or post-printing treatments to achieve desired properties.

    Print Speed: AM can be a time-consuming process, especially for large or complex objects, which could affect the pace of your story's events.

    Cost: The equipment, materials, and expertise required for AM can be expensive, potentially affecting your story's setting or the accessibility of the technology.

    Adhesion in Materials Science for Science Fiction Writers

    Adhesion is a fundamental concept in materials science that refers to the sticking or bonding of two surfaces together.

    What is Adhesion?

    Adhesion is the force that holds two surfaces together when they come into contact. It occurs when the molecules of one material attract and bond with the molecules of another material.

    Importance in Science Fiction

    Adhesion plays a role in science fiction storytelling. Here's why:

    Structural Stability: Adhesion determines the strength and stability of connections between materials. Whether it's the hull of a spaceship, the joints of a robotic exoskeleton, or the adhesion of scales on an alien creature, understanding adhesion can help you create believable and functional designs.

    Stickiness and Grappling: Adhesion can be used to depict sticky substances, like alien secretions or futuristic adhesives that characters use to climb walls or immobilize enemies. It adds excitement and intrigue to action scenes.

    Material Compatibility: Different materials have varying adhesion properties. Exploring the compatibility between materials can enhance the realism of your world. For example, characters might struggle to bond two incompatible materials, leading to plot obstacles or the need to find innovative solutions.

    Factors Affecting Adhesion

    Several factors influence adhesion in materials science:

    Surface Preparation The preparation of surfaces before bonding is essential. Roughening, cleaning, or applying primers can enhance adhesion by increasing the contact area and removing contaminants.

    Molecular Interactions: The chemical compatibility between materials determines the strength of adhesion. Strong intermolecular forces, like hydrogen bonding or electrostatic attraction, promote better adhesion.

    Temperature and Environment: Adhesion can be affected by temperature, humidity, and other environmental conditions. Characters in your story might need to consider these factors when dealing with adhesion-related challenges.

    Adhesion Techniques

    Materials scientists employ various techniques to enhance adhesion:

    Adhesive Bonding: Using specialized adhesives or glues to bond materials together. This is useful for creating seamless connections or repairing damaged items.

    Surface Treatments: Techniques like sanding, etching, or applying coatings can improve adhesion by modifying the surface properties of materials.

    Mechanical Interlocking: Creating interlocking features or structures that mechanically hold materials together, such as hooks, tabs, or interlocking ridges.

    Aerospace Materials in Materials Science for Science Fiction Writers

    Aerospace materials are an essential aspect of science fiction storytelling when crafting futuristic aircraft, spacecraft, or advanced technologies.

    Introduction to Aerospace Materials

    Aerospace materials are specially designed materials used in the construction of aircraft and spacecraft. They possess unique properties that enable them to withstand extreme conditions, like high temperatures, intense vibrations, and exposure to space environments.

    Common Aerospace Materials

    Here are some important materials used in aerospace applications:

    Aluminum Alloys: Lightweight and corrosion-resistant, aluminum alloys are widely used in aerospace structures like aircraft frames and panels.

    Titanium Alloys: Known for their exceptional strength-to-weight ratio, titanium alloys are used in components that require high strength, like aircraft engines and critical structural parts.

    Composite Materials: Composites are made by combining two or more materials with different properties. They offer high strength, low weight, and resistance to fatigue. Carbon fiber composites, for example, are used in aerospace applications to reduce weight while maintaining structural integrity.

    Ceramic Matrix Composites: These materials comprise ceramic fibers embedded in a ceramic matrix, offering exceptional heat resistance. They are used in components exposed to high temperatures, like jet engine parts and thermal protection systems for spacecraft.

    Applications in Science Fiction

    Aerospace materials can inspire intriguing science fiction concepts:

    Advanced Spacecraft: Imagine spacecraft made of lightweight but strong materials, allowing for faster and more efficient interstellar travel.

    Stealth Technologies: Fictional aircraft or spacecraft constructed with materials that absorb or reflect radar signals, enabling stealth capabilities.

    Energy Shields: Materials that possess unique electromagnetic properties, capable of generating protective energy shields around vehicles or structures.

    Advanced Armor: Composite materials offer enhanced protection against projectiles, lasers, or other forms of attacks.

    Challenges and Limitations

    While aerospace materials have remarkable properties, they also face challenges:

    Cost: Advanced aerospace materials can be expensive to produce and work with, limiting their widespread use.

    Manufacturing Techniques: Specialized manufacturing processes are sometimes required for aerospace materials, which may pose challenges in terms of availability and feasibility.

    Environmental Impact: The production and disposal of aerospace materials can have environmental consequences, which may be a consideration in your story.

    Alloys in Materials Science for Science Fiction Writers

    Alloys are fascinating materials that can add depth and realism to your science fiction writing.

    What are Alloys?

    Alloys are materials made by combining two or more metallic elements. They are created by melting and mixing the metals together, resulting in a solid material with properties different from those of the individual elements.

    Benefits of Alloys

    Alloys offer several advantages. This makes them popular in various applications:

    Enhanced Strength: Alloys can be stronger and more durable than pure metals. They withstand forces and stresses that individual metals may not handle.

    Improved Corrosion Resistance: Some alloys exhibit excellent resistance to corrosion. This makes them ideal for applications in harsh environments, like underwater or in outer space.

    Customizable Properties: By adjusting the composition and proportions of alloying elements, scientists can tailor specific characteristics, like hardness, conductivity, or magnetism, to suit particular needs.

    Common Types of Alloys

    There are many types of alloys, each with its unique properties and applications:

    Steel: Steel is an alloy primarily composed of iron and carbon, with additional elements like chromium, nickel, or manganese. We know it for its strength, versatility, and widespread use in construction, transportation, and weaponry.

    Brass: Brass is an alloy of copper and zinc. It has a bright appearance and is valued for its corrosion resistance and malleability. Brass is sometimes used in musical instruments, decorative items, and plumbing fittings.

    Bronze: Bronze is an alloy primarily composed of copper and tin, with other elements sometimes added. We know it for its strength, durability, and historical significance. Bronze has been used for statues, coins, and various tools throughout history.

    Aluminum Alloys: Aluminum alloys combine aluminum with other elements like copper, magnesium, or zinc. They are lightweight, corrosion-resistant, and widely used in aerospace, automotive, and structural applications.

    Applications in Science Fiction

    Alloys can inspire exciting concepts and technologies in your science fiction stories:

    Futuristic Materials: Imagine advanced alloys that possess extraordinary properties, like shape-shifting capabilities, self-healing abilities, or the ability to generate energy.

    Alien Alloys: Create alloys unique to alien civilizations, with properties beyond human comprehension. These alloys might be central to their advanced technologies or have mysterious properties.

    Superpowered Alloys: Develop alloys that grant extraordinary abilities to characters, like super strength, energy manipulation, or the power to control magnetic fields

    Amorphous Materials in Materials Science for Science Fiction Writers

    Amorphous materials are intriguing substances that can add a touch of mystery and wonder to your science fiction storytelling.

    What are Amorphous Materials?

    Amorphous materials are substances that lack a regular, repeating atomic structure found in crystalline materials. Instead, their atoms or molecules are arranged in a disordered, non-repetitive fashion. This disorder gives amorphous materials distinct properties and characteristics.
